"Best platform for any level of programmers"

What do you like best? The platform is so simple and intuitive for may level of programmers to code and learn new techniques. Every question has a discussion panel which makes it much easier to learn new things. Unlocking new test cases using hackos is a pretty cool thing which let's us find out what we have missed in our logic
